Price Ranges For Arrowheads. Stone arrowheads have some monetary value, although it is generally low. On average common arrowheads can be sold for between $5 and $20. The Cherokee used arrowheads, spear points, stone weapons, axes, tomahawks, blowguns and poisoned darts for their weapons and hammer stones, deer antlers and fire as tools in shapi...7 Field Tips for Hunting Arrowheads and Artifacts. 1. Use a Map. Use a topographic “quad” map (“quadrangle” maps usually refer to a United States Geological Survey map) to locate likely areas to search. Topo maps provide very detailed land topography, altitude, and waterways from major to small drainages.Arrowheads are unlikely to be found in areas where game was scarce and where territory was of little strategic value. This is another famous archaeological site in Texas, where small pieces of limestone with elaborate engravings have been found, as well as many Clovis points associated with the Paleo-Indian culture. Small gravel: a high chance of finding bird points (small arrowheads) and other small arrowheads. Pea gravel: better chance of finding bird points. Arrowheads may be found throughout Texas, but you’ll have more luck arrowhead hunting in areas where Native American activity was greatest. All Native American tribes relied on arrowheads for important societal functions, such as hunting, fishing, and warfare. Used to hunt small game such as frogs and rabbits, the projectile point is one of 150,000 artifacts greater than 14,000 years old found at the Gault archeological site. The site bears evidence of nearly continuous human occupation. Discovered in central Texas, this stone point with a broken tip was made at least 14,000 years ago.
